What to Consider Before Adoption
Bringing a pet home is a big and rewarding decision. Before adopting, please consider the following:
-
Pets require a significant time commitment.
-
A pet’s lifespan can range from 5 to 20 years.
-
Some animals do better with children than others—please think about your current and future household needs.
-
Pet care involves ongoing financial responsibility, including food, toys, veterinary care, and preventative medications.
After adoption, we recommend keeping your new pet quarantined for 14 days to help them adjust and stay healthy.

Meeting Your Potential Pet
When you arrive at the Adoption Center, we encourage you and your family to spend time with the animals you’re interested in to find the best fit. Our trained staff and volunteers are happy to answer questions and share any background information we have.
Please keep in mind that we don’t always know an animal’s full history, depending on how they came to SPCA Florida.
If you already have a dog at home, we may ask you to bring them in for a meet-and-greet, as some dogs are selective about new canine companions. In these cases, your dog must be up to date on rabies and DHPP vaccinations.

Adoption Fees
Adoption fees vary depending on species, breed, and age.
The fee includes:
-
Spay/Neuter surgery for unsterilized pets
-
Dogs are dewormed, tested for heartworms
-
If negative they receive a 30-day heartworm preventative
-
If positive, treatment is paid for by the Guardian Angel Fund at SPCA Florida’s Medical Center), and receive vaccinations for canine distemper, adenovirus type 2, parainfluenza, parvovirus, and rabies (if age-appropriate)
-
-
Cats are dewormed, tested for feline leukemia and FIV, and receive vaccinations for feline distemper, rhinotracheitis, calici virus, and rabies (if age-appropriate)
-
Microchip
-
Educational material
